Trash truck in philadelphias juniata section this morning. Action news has learned the search for the man began shortly before 6 00 a. M. On the 300 block of east erie avenue. Police say the man was sleeping in a dumpster when it was lifted into a Waste Management truck. Rescue crews spent nearly two hours trying to get him out of the truck. He was taken to Temple University hospital with lowerable hip and leg injuries. A crash involved three vehicles that happened about 6 oclock last night in the area of 495 and route 141. Officials say the 80yearold suffered head and facial injuries and remains hospitalized. Two other people at the scene were checked out by paramedics. No word on what caused the collision. Gunshot wound to the head. Reporter over months after the murder of 64yearold Michael Mcnew bucks County District attorney announced an arrest in this case. Investigators charged 33yearold Jennifer Lynn morrissey with criminal homicide burglary and other charges. Not always mediate when you can catch a killer and in this instance it took a lot of cooperation, collaboration and just good Old Fashioned detective work. Reporter mcnew was found shot to death inside of his home along the Delaware River in Washington Crossing august 8th. The District Attorney confirms mcnew and morrissey lived together since the beginning of january of 2015. According to court documents, he wanted her out of the house and that likely fueled her anger and led to the shooting. News of the murder rattled this close knit community.
